BlackBerry Goes Bold with New 3G Smartphone (NewsFactor)   12 May 2008 15:48 GMT
NewsFactor - BlackBerry has gone bold and high-speed. On Monday, Research In Motion (RIM) announced the BlackBerry Bold, a new mobile device that it said will give business users "unprecedented functionality and performance" as the first BlackBerry to support tri-band HSDPA.

RIM's BlackBerry Bold beats Apple to the 3G punch   12 May 2008 10:21 GMT
Amid swirling rumors about the impending announcement of a 3G iPhone, Research in Motion today introduced its slickest, speediest, most powerful, and most connected BlackBerry to date: the BlackBerry Bold 9000.

AT&T yanks iPhone free Wi-Fi info from site   09 May 2008 12:17 GMT
Only hours after posting information that indicated iPhone owners would receive free access to AT&T's public wireless hotspots, the company pulled all references to the service from its Web site.

Cablevision plans Wi-Fi network in NYC   08 May 2008 19:46 GMT
A day after Comcast and Time Warner Cable announced investments in a WiMax joint venture spearheaded by Sprint and Clearwire, Cablevision said it would build its own wireless broadband network, using Wi-Fi.

T-Mobile's 3G Rollout Lags Behind Competitors (NewsFactor)   08 May 2008 16:24 GMT
NewsFactor - T-Mobile USA is now joining the 3G club. Earlier this week, the telecommunications company announced that it has begun the commercial rollout of its third-generation wireless network, starting with New York City.

Microsoft to increase focus on handsets for poor   08 May 2008 14:23 GMT
Microsoft will increase its focus on making mobile phones part of its strategy to spread IT to people in developing nations, based partly on a prototype already developed for the purpose called Fone+ .
